The Gettysburg Community Theatre, the non profit 501c3 community theatre now in its 6th year in the old Elks Lodge at 49 York Street within the first block if Lincoln Square in historic downtown Gettysburg, will once again be part of The Gettysburg Fringe Festival as they present their musical The Secret Garden, based on the novel by Frances Hodgson Burnett, on June 12, 13, 20 & 21 at 7pm and June 15 & 22 at 2pm at GCT, as well as present the annual Canary Cabaret At The Blue Parrot Bistro on June 13 & 14 at 10pm at The Blue Parrot Bistro located at 35 Chambersburg Street in downtown Gettysburg.

 

 

GCT’s Founding Executive/Artistic Director, Chad-Alan Carr, is very pleased to once again host the annual Festival tradition of the Canary Cabaret At The Blue Parrot Bistro, with this year’s cast of singers from PA, D.C. and NYC presenting their favorite songs of everything from Broadway to The Beatles! Singers will include local favorite and Broadway Veteran, Bruce Moore, Gettysburg College Alumni Ed Riggs, Sean Mott and Kyleigh Grim, GAHS Assistant Band Director Carrie Trax accompanied on guitar by her father David Conklin who is the GAHS Band Director, joined by Dustin LeBlanc and Lindsay Bretz-Morgan from Carlisle Theatre Company, Robyn Colossa who studied Musical Theatre in NYC, and York’s Emily Falvey who once opened for The Oakridge Boys, along with Mary George and Adam Rineer at the piano with many more singers from PA theatres as well. The Canary Cabaret At The Blue Parrot Bistro has a $10 cover for all. Dinner reservations before 9pm can be made at The Blue Parrot Bistro to be sure patrons get the best seats for the cabaret. This year’s cabaret Broadway To The Beatles is a benefit for GCT’s Taylor Zimmerman Memorial Scholarship.

 

 

Broadway Veteran and Gettysburg native, Bruce Moore, directs the musical The Secret Garden at Gettysburg Community Theatre this June 12-22. Tickets are $15 limited reserved seating and include complimentary refreshments. The cast features Gettysburg College Alumni Sean Mott and Kyleigh Grim, along with Hanover resident Alyssa Meyers and Gettysburg residents Grant Sanders, Robyn Colossa and Harrison Crow as the leading characters along with a cast of 30 children, teens and adults from all over the Adams/York counties. Adam Rineer music directs and Becca Willett stage manages this beautiful musical, based on the novel of the same name, is about a girl who loses her parents and must find happiness in a secret garden with her new family at her uncle’s home. The Canary Cabaret At The Blue Parrot Bistro and The Secret Garden musical at GCT are part of the Gettysburg Fringe Festival, the community compliment to the Gettysburg Festival June 12-15, 2014. The Fringe Festival showcases a comprehensive collection of community events taking place within Adams County’s thriving arts community. The Gettysburg Fringe Festival enhances the Gettysburg Festival.
